Kinds Of Exercise Bikes

There are numerous types of stationary bicycle, and comprehending the differences can help you find one that fits your requirements.

1. Upright Bikes

These resemble traditional bicycles and require users to maintain an upright position. Ideal for those who delight in the biking experience.

2. Recumbent Bikes

Recumbent bikes enable users to sit in a more unwinded position with back support. This is helpful for those with back issues or movement issues.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. How much should I invest on a stationary bicycle?

Prices can range from ₤ 100 for fundamental designs to over ₤ 2,000 for high-end spin bikes. Determine your budget plan based upon functions and your physical fitness goals.

2. What size bike do I need?

Think about the area offered in your home. Measure the location where you plan to put the bike, and inspect measurements when shopping.

3. Are stationary bicycle suitable for all fitness levels?

Yes, stationary bicycle are flexible and can suit beginners to sophisticated athletes. Try to find designs with adjustable resistance.

4. Do I need to wear special shoes?

While not required, biking shoes can improve your experience on spin bikes by supplying better pedal grip.

5. Is it much better to buy new or utilized?

New bikes include service warranties and the most current features, while used bikes can conserve cash but may require more evaluation for wear and tear.
